Transaction 9852089352d0528745242abbca4a58431f5ab38a9891829e951351f8c4b8326c
1 Input
1 Output
-
9852089352d0528745242abbca4a58431f5ab38a9891829e951351f8c4b8326c:0
- value
- 8993763
- script pubkey
- OP_0 OP_PUSHBYTES_20 e15ef13f95673047ba574db5e1b97b460cb2af2d
- address
- bc1qu900z0u4vucy0wjhfk67rwtmgcxt9ted8fgela